Rugged embedded computer family

Online Editor

MPL has introduced another ultra-compact computer family with a case dimensions of only 62 x 162 x 118mm, based on the 10nm Intel Atom x6000 processor. Despite the small footprint, the system still has MPL’s typical product characteristics, such as: robustness; the highest reliability; long-term availability of at least 10 years; lowest power consumption; extended temperature (-40°C to 85°C) capability; passive cooling (fanless); and easy internal expansion.

The CEC2x family comes with onboard NVMe mass storage (120GB, optional up to 1TB). The solution supports various other types of mass storage as well. The onboard m.2 Key-B slot can be used for multiple expansion options. The board is equipped with a high density expansion connector with PCIe, USB and I2C interfaces. This allows users to expand the CEC2x with MPL’s standard I/O board ( FIME) or semi-custom designed I/O board according to individual needs.

For maximum robustness the CEC2x is designed to operate in the range of -20°C to 60°C and optionally even at -40°C up to 85°C and withstand reverse polarity voltage, over-voltage, surge and burst voltages, as well as electromagnetic discharges targeting the MIL-STD-461E, IEC60945 and EN50155 standards.

The CEC2x expansion board (FIME) offers up to 3 x mPCIe slots,SATA, DVI-D, VGA, and 2 x 2.5Gbte LAN ports. This allows a maximum on customization for any I/O Boards and extending the system with additional interfaces. Additional interfaces (1553, ARIC, CAN, LTE and more) can be added over the mPCIe slots.

The new CEC20 family is available with a DIN-Rail or flange mount compact aluminium housing, a MIL housing with 38999 connectors according customer requirements, as a 19” rack solution, or as open frame with a cooling concept.
